Abstract
The invention discloses a plate conveyor, which comprises a rack and a conveying device arranged above the rack, wherein the conveying device comprises two symmetrically arranged conveying channels, the conveying channels are connected with a controller, the conveying channels and a rack body form a cavity, the outer side edges of the conveying channels are provided with flanges, a space is arranged between the two conveying channels, the width of a clamping mechanical arm is smaller than that of the space, the bottom of the cavity is provided with a flexible bottom plate, and the size of the flexible bottom plate is the same as that of the bottom of the cavity. The plate conveyor is reasonable in structure and convenient to operate, can be used for transporting plates quickly and efficiently, reduces the damage rate of the plates, and has high practical value in the mechanical field.
Description
Technical Field
The invention relates to the field of machining, in particular to a plate conveyor.
Background
As everyone knows, need come to plate transportation and unloading through transport mechanism in the process of plate processing, through the arm with the plate centre gripping that processing was accomplished to the conveyer belt on, then transport to unloading mechanism and use or deposit, in the arm centre gripping process, all be the outside as to the conveyer belt with clamping part to avoid bumping the conveyer belt and leading to damaging, like this, the both sides of conveyer belt can not increase the barrier plate, lead to the easy landing of plate, the efficiency of carrying is also relatively lower. Therefore, improvements in the prior art are needed.
Disclosure of Invention
In order to overcome the defects in the prior art, the plate conveyor is provided, so that the plate is prevented from sliding off in the transportation process to influence the efficiency.
The invention provides a plate conveyor which comprises a rack and a conveying device arranged above the rack, wherein the conveying device comprises two symmetrically arranged conveying channels, the conveying channels are connected with a controller, a cavity is formed between each conveying channel and the rack, a retaining edge is arranged on the outer side edge of each conveying channel, a space is arranged between the two conveying channels, the width of a clamping mechanical arm is smaller than that of the space, a flexible bottom plate is arranged at the bottom of the cavity, and the size of the flexible bottom plate is the same as that of the bottom of the cavity.
In a further improvement, the flexible base plate is made of rubber.
The further improvement is that the conveying channel is provided with a plurality of bumps, and the height of each bump is the same.
In a further improvement, the bumps are provided with stripes.
Due to the adoption of the technical scheme, the invention has the beneficial effects that:
1. the plate cannot slide or shift in the conveying process;
2. when the plate accidentally slides into the cavity, the collision can be buffered to reduce the damage;
3. the friction force of the plate in the transportation process is increased, and the efficiency is improved.

Detailed Description
In order to make the technical means, the inventive features, the objectives and the effects of the invention easy to understand, the invention will be further described with reference to the accompanying drawings.
The embodiment of the invention provides a plate conveyor, as shown in fig. 1 to 4, comprising a frame 1 and a conveying device arranged above the frame 1, wherein the conveying device comprises two symmetrically arranged conveying channels 2, the conveying channels 2 are connected with a controller, the conveying channels 2 and the frame 1 form a cavity 3, the outer side edges of the conveying channels 2 are provided with flanges 4 for limiting, a space is arranged between the two conveying channels 2, the width of a clamping mechanical arm 5 is smaller than that of the space, so that the clamping mechanical arm 5 clamps a plate 6 in the space, the clamping operation is carried out in the longitudinal direction of the conveying channel 2, the flexible bottom plate 7 is arranged at the bottom of the cavity 3, the size of the flexible bottom plate 7 is the same as that of the bottom of the cavity 3, the flexible bottom plate 7 is made of rubber materials, other flexible materials can be used besides the rubber materials, and the plate 6 which slides down can be buffered.
In addition, as shown in fig. 5, the conveying path 2 is provided with a plurality of bumps 8, each bump 8 has the same height, the bumps 8 are provided with stripes, and the bumps 8 and the stripes are arranged to play a role in increasing friction, so that the plate 6 is prevented from slipping with the conveying path 2 in the transportation process and stopping in place or the conveying speed is reduced, and the conveying efficiency is improved.
In the concrete use, as shown in fig. 6 and 7, the plate 6 which is processed through the clamping mechanical arm 5 is placed above the two conveying channels 2, the clamping mechanical arm 5 continues to clamp another plate 6 on the conveying channels 2 while the plate is conveyed forwards through the conveying channels 2, the plate is conveyed forwards to the material receiving device in sequence to be received, when the plate 6 carelessly falls into the cavity 3, the bottom of the plate is the flexible bottom plate 7, the plate 6 can be buffered, and the damage is reduced.
The plate conveyor disclosed by the invention is reasonable in structure and convenient to operate, can be used for rapidly and efficiently conveying the plate 6, reduces the damage rate of the plate 6 and has high practical value in the mechanical field.
